How can I check the transaction ID for a Bitcoin transfer?

I recently made a Bitcoin transfer and I want to check the transaction ID. How can I do that? Is there a specific website or platform I can use to find the transaction ID?

3 answers
- Sure thing! Checking the transaction ID for a Bitcoin transfer is quite simple. All you need to do is go to a blockchain explorer website like blockchain.com or blockchair.com. On these websites, you can enter your Bitcoin wallet address or the transaction ID itself to find the details of the transaction, including the transaction ID. It's a quick and easy way to verify your Bitcoin transfer.
